What We Can and Cannot Move
Items Typically Included
- Household furniture: sofas, beds, wardrobes, tables, chairs
- Appliances: washing machines, fridges, freezers (properly defrosted)
- Boxes and bags of personal belongings
- Office equipment: desks, chairs, filing cabinets, printers
- Electronics: TVs, computers, audio equipment (securely wrapped)
- Student belongings and small loads into storage
Items Normally Excluded
For safety, legal and insurance reasons, we generally cannot move:
- Hazardous materials (paint, fuel, gas bottles, chemicals)
- Illegal or stolen goods
- Live animals or pets
- Open containers of liquids that may leak
- Very high-value items such as fine art or jewellery without prior agreement
If you’re unsure about a particular item, just ask when you enquire and we’ll confirm what’s possible and whether any special arrangements are needed.
How Our Man with a Van Process Works
1. Enquiry & Quote
Contact us by phone, email or online form with your collection and delivery addresses, access details, and a rough list of what you’re moving. We’ll ask a few questions to understand stair access, parking, and any fragile or bulky items. Based on this, we provide a clear, no-obligation quote.
2. Survey (Virtual or Onsite)
For larger moves or tricky access, we recommend a short virtual survey (video call) or an onsite visit in Harold Wood. This lets us assess parking, staircases, lift size, and item volume accurately so we send the right van size and team. It prevents surprises on the day and keeps costs accurate.
3. Packing & Preparation
You can pack your own items, or we can supply materials such as boxes, tape and wrapping. On request, our team can provide a packing service where we wrap and box your belongings for you. We always protect furniture with blankets, covers and, where needed, specialist wrapping to prevent damage during transit.
4. Loading & Transport
On moving day, our trained team arrives on time, carries out a quick walk-through, and plans the loading order. We use trolleys, straps and protective blankets to load safely and efficiently. Once loaded, we transport your goods in our well-maintained, fully insured vans, using sensible routes and driving styles that prioritise the security of your belongings.
5. Unloading & Placement
At your new address, we unload carefully and place items into the rooms you indicate. We can reassemble basic furniture by prior arrangement and will check with you before leaving to ensure everything is where it should be and nothing is missing.
Transparent Pricing Explained
We believe in straightforward, transparent pricing. Depending on your needs, we can quote on an hourly rate or a fixed-price basis:
- Hourly rate – best for small, local moves where the scope is simple.
- Fixed price – ideal for larger moves or when you want complete cost certainty upfront.
Your price is based on the distance travelled, volume of goods, level of service (driver only or driver plus additional movers), access conditions, and any extras such as packing or furniture assembly. There are no hidden charges: we explain all costs clearly before you book.

Frequently Asked Questions
How much does a man with a van in Harold Wood cost?
Costs vary depending on the volume of items, distance, access, and whether you need one or more movers. For small local moves we usually charge an hourly rate, with a minimum booking period. Larger or more complex moves can be priced as a fixed quote so you know the total in advance. To give an accurate figure, we’ll ask about addresses, stairs or lifts, parking, and what you’re moving. All prices are explained clearly with no hidden extras.
Can you provide same-day or urgent man with a van services?
Yes, we can often accommodate same-day or urgent bookings in Harold Wood, particularly on weekdays and outside peak times. Availability depends on our existing schedule and the size of your move, so it’s best to call as early as possible. If we can help, we’ll give you a realistic arrival window and confirm what we can achieve within the time you have. Even for urgent moves, we still work safely and ensure items are properly protected and loaded.
Are my belongings insured during the move?
Yes. Your belongings are covered by our goods in transit insurance while they’re in our vehicle, and we also carry public liability cover for work at your property. This protects you against most common risks during a move. There are standard exclusions and limits, which we’re happy to explain when you book, and we’ll advise you if any particularly high-value or unusual items need additional cover or special handling. We also reduce risk by using protective materials and careful loading techniques.
What is included in your man with a van service?
Our standard service includes a vehicle, a professional driver-mover, loading, transport and unloading at your new address. We bring protective blankets, straps and basic tools for simple furniture disassembly or reassembly if agreed in advance. At your destination, we place items into the rooms you choose. Optional extras include additional movers, packing services and packing materials. We will confirm exactly what’s included in your quote so you know what to expect on the day.

How far in advance should I book?
For the best choice of dates and times, we recommend booking your man with a van service 1–2 weeks in advance, especially if you’re moving on a Friday, weekend or at month-end, when demand is highest. That said, we understand that moves are not always planned, and we regularly accommodate last-minute requests where our schedule allows. Even if your dates aren’t fixed yet, it’s worth getting in touch early so we can advise on availability and options.
